Transaction 320fcae61baba5d1ebb1fb559e7a233db740007344bcf7e2d10305bfdcaed5d6

2 Input
2 Outputs
  • 320fcae61baba5d1ebb1fb559e7a233db740007344bcf7e2d10305bfdcaed5d6:0
  • value  159996
    address  1KsbRsRPbYL8b1PUb9UD5GZKFmpKvZrpcv
  • 320fcae61baba5d1ebb1fb559e7a233db740007344bcf7e2d10305bfdcaed5d6:1
  • value  4226958
    address  33gyPCVCb1dHVZrb9fAwKeSv7QM52vHcgr